WebMay 18, 2024 · In most cases, sole traders will not have a vehicle that’s designated exclusively for business use. Although you might use your vehicle to travel to meet customers, it’s highly likely that it will also be used for other purposes, such as doing your family grocery shopping. Your logbook is then used to calculate the “business use percentage” of your car across the year. Your business use percentage is the percentage of kilometres you travel in your car for work-related purposes. thinkcar storeWebWhether you’re a contractor, sole trader or running a business, you claim your business expenses annually in your tax return.
